A leading logistics company in Bedford seeks qualified Class 1 and Class 2 HGV Drivers for long-term positions. The role entails safely transporting goods on designated routes, providing exceptional customer service, and maintaining HGV vehicles.
Candidates must possess a valid HGV licence and CPC qualification, along with excellent driving records.
The company offers stable working hours with opportunities for overtime earnings along with a comprehensive benefits package including pension, life assurance, and career development support.

How to prepare for a job interview at Whistl UK Ltd
β¨Know Your Routes
Familiarise yourself with the routes you might be driving. Being able to discuss your knowledge of local roads and traffic patterns can impress the interviewers and show that you're proactive.
β¨Highlight Your Experience
Prepare specific examples from your past driving experience that demonstrate your ability to handle challenges on the road, such as difficult weather conditions or tight delivery schedules. This will help you stand out as a reliable candidate.
β¨Showcase Customer Service Skills
Since providing exceptional customer service is key in this role, think of instances where you've gone above and beyond for customers. Be ready to share these stories to illustrate your commitment to great service.
β¨Discuss Vehicle Maintenance Knowledge
Make sure to mention your understanding of HGV vehicle maintenance. Discuss any relevant experience you have with keeping vehicles in top condition, as this shows responsibility and care for the equipment you'll be using.
